A Certified Professional in Education Advocacy and Policy Development Initiatives certification equips professionals with the skills to navigate the complex landscape of education policy and advocacy. This program fosters expertise in research, analysis, and strategic communication, crucial for influencing educational reforms and improving student outcomes.
Learning outcomes typically include mastering policy analysis techniques, developing effective advocacy strategies, understanding relevant legislation, and effectively communicating policy recommendations to diverse stakeholders. Graduates often demonstrate proficiency in data-driven decision making and collaborative policy development within educational settings.
